The Right Fit

The most important factor in purchasing ladies leather gloves is fit. So how do you know what size glove you are?
Begin by measuring your hand.
Hold your hand up or lay it flat on the table and measure the widest part of your hand – across the four lower (base) knuckles – excluding the thumb.
Anything less than 6 inches will be an extra small sized glove.
6.5 inches is ladies size small. 7 inches is medium. 7.5 inches is ladies size large and 8 inches is an extra large glove size.
Style
Once you know the correct size, it all comes down to style and length.
Ladies leather gloves are available in lengths from wrist to above the elbow.
They’re also lined in several different materials which may include cashmere, silk, fur (both real and faux) and wool.
Some ladies leather gloves are elastic at the wrist for a snugger fit to keep the cold air out and some are designed with venting both at the wrist and throughout the glove to allow air in.
Also, be sure to look for details like open fingers, buttons, buckles and stitching, as well as a multitude of colors to match all of your winter outfits.
Quality
While North America now manufactures quality ladies leather gloves, Italy is more recognized for its renowned fine leather products, including of course, ladies leather gloves.
To ensure shape retention after they’ve been worn, Italian ladies leather gloves are hand stretched to create elasticity. They also undergo a special process that enhances the leather’s natural color.
Cost
Authentic Italian ladies leather gloves usually average somewhere between $50 and $100.
There are of course many lower priced ladies leather gloves to choose from depending on the type of leather and the manufacturer.
The bottom line when purchasing ladies leather gloves is to first be sure the size is right and from there, its basically a matter of personal taste and desired function.
If your gloves are more of a fashion accessory rather than a source of cold weather protection, it isn’t necessary to choose wool, cashmere or fur linings.
